Flooded Lead Acid Batteries: Reliable Classics

Flooded lead acid batteries have been the go-to choice for RV solar power systems for years. They’re known for their dependability and have a track record of performance. These batteries use a simple technology where lead plates are submerged in an electrolyte solution, creating a chemical reaction that stores electricity.

Cons: The Flip Side of Flooded Lead Acid Batteries

While flooded lead acid batteries have their advantages, they also come with drawbacks. Being aware of these will help you make an informed decision.

  • Maintenance: They require regular watering and cleaning to keep them functioning properly.
  • Ventilation: These batteries emit gases during charging and need proper ventilation to ensure safety.
  • Weight: Flooded lead acid batteries are heavy, which might be a concern for weight-sensitive RVs.
  • Sensitivity to Deep Discharges: Repeated deep discharges can shorten their lifespan significantly.
  • Temperature Sensitivity: Their performance can be affected by extreme temperatures.

Maintenance Tips for Flooded Lead Acid Batteries

Keeping your flooded lead acid batteries in top shape is key to ensuring a long and useful life. Regular maintenance checks are essential. Make sure to top up the water levels with distilled water, as tap water can introduce minerals that harm the battery. Clean any corrosion from the terminals with a mix of baking soda and water to prevent loss of conductivity. Also, keep an eye on the charge levels; avoid letting the battery discharge below 50% to prevent damage.

Solar Gel RV Batteries: The Sealed Alternative

Gel batteries are a type of sealed lead-acid battery that offer a maintenance-free experience for RV owners. Unlike their flooded counterparts, gel batteries contain a thick, jelly-like electrolyte that doesn’t spill or require topping up. This makes them an excellent choice for RVs, especially if you prefer a set-it-and-forget-it approach to battery maintenance.

Understanding the Composition of Gel Batteries

Gel batteries use a silica additive that causes the electrolyte to set into a gel. This not only prevents spills but also reduces the evaporation and fumes that come with traditional flooded batteries. The sealed design also means they’re less susceptible to vibration and can be mounted in various positions, giving you more flexibility in tight RV spaces.

Challenges and Considerations with Gel Batteries

While gel batteries have many benefits, they’re not without their challenges. They’re generally more expensive than flooded lead acid batteries, so initial investment is higher. They also require a specific charging profile that’s different from other battery types; using the wrong charger can irreversibly damage them. Additionally, gel batteries are sensitive to high temperatures, which can reduce their lifespan and effectiveness.

Maximizing the Lifespan of Your Gel RV Battery

To get the most out of your gel batteries, it’s crucial to use a compatible charger and follow the manufacturer’s charging guidelines. Keep them in a cool, dry place to avoid temperature extremes. It’s also important to monitor the depth of discharge; try not to deplete the battery completely before recharging. Life Expectancy and Durability in the RV Environment

Flooded lead acid batteries typically last between 3 to 5 years, while gel batteries can last up to 7 years or more with proper care. Durability is also a factor; flooded batteries can be more prone to damage from rough handling or extreme vibrations that are common in RV travel. Gel batteries, with their solid-state design, are better equipped to handle these conditions without leaking or suffering damage.

Discharge and Recharge: Analyzing the Efficiency

Efficiency during discharge and recharge cycles is crucial for solar RV systems. Flooded lead acid batteries have a lower cost per amp-hour over their lifetime but can suffer from reduced capacity when frequently deeply discharged. Gel batteries are more tolerant of deep discharge cycles without significant capacity loss, making them more efficient in how they store and release energy.

How often do I need to maintain my solar RV battery?

The frequency of maintenance for your solar RV battery depends on the type:

– Flooded lead acid batteries typically require monthly maintenance, including checking water levels and cleaning terminals.
– Gel batteries are virtually maintenance-free, but it’s good practice to inspect them periodically for any signs of damage or wear.

Can I upgrade from flooded lead acid to gel batteries easily?

Upgrading from flooded lead acid to gel batteries is possible but requires some consideration:

– Ensure your charging system is compatible with gel batteries or can be adjusted to their specific charging needs.
– Account for the higher initial cost when switching to gel batteries.
– Measure your battery compartment to ensure the gel batteries will fit properly.

If you’re unsure about the upgrade process, it’s always best to consult with a solar power specialist to ensure a smooth transition.

Is there a difference in charging methods for these battery types?

Yes, flooded lead acid and gel batteries require different charging methods. Flooded batteries can handle more aggressive charging, while gel batteries need a more controlled approach to avoid damage. Always use a charger that is compatible with your battery type and follow the manufacturer’s recommendations.
